开业 (kāi yè) is commonly used in a sentence to refer to the act of starting a business or officially opening a new business. It can also be used to describe the beginning of a new venture or operation.
Example sentences:
1. 我们的公司将在下个月开业。(Wǒmen de gōngsī jiāng zài xià gè yuè kāi yè.) - Our company will open for business next month.
2. 他们的餐厅今天正式开业了。(Tāmen de cāntīng jīntiān zhèngshì kāi yè le.) - Their restaurant officially opened for business today.
3. 这家商店已经开业一年了,生意非常好。(Zhè jiā shāngdiàn yǐjīng kāi yè yī nián le, shēngyì fēicháng hǎo.) - This store has been in operation for a year now and business is doing very well.
